Cold Brew Oolong Tea
Cold brew oolong tea is a refreshing beverage made from oolong tea leaves steeped in cold water, resulting in a smooth, aromatic drink that retains the unique flavors and health benefits of oolong tea.
Kombucha Ginger Lemon
Kombucha Ginger Lemon is a fermented tea beverage known for its refreshing taste and potential health benefits, including improved digestion and enhanced immune function.
